Projekt

Obecné

Profil

« Předchozí | Další » 

Revize 2c2cad8d

Přidáno uživatelem Martin Sebela před více než 3 roky(ů)

Re #8190 - fix popup colors

Zobrazit rozdíly:

website/public/js/zcu-heatmap.js
312 312
  return Object.keys(info).length > 1
313 313
}
314 314

  
315
const setNewPopupDatasetName = (datasetName) => {
316
  const popup = $('.leaflet-popup')
317

  
318
  popup.removeClass(function (index, css) {
319
    return (css.match (/(^|\s)popup-\S+/g) || []).join(' ');
320
  })
321
  popup.addClass(`popup-${datasetName}`)
322
}
323

  
315 324
function showInfo (e) {
316 325
  info = []
317 326
  currentPageInPopup = 0
......
383 392
      globalPopup._popup = prepareLayerPopUp(lat, lng, i, `popup-${infoDict.datasetName}`)
384 393
      globalPopup.coord = eventCoord
385 394
    }
395
    else {
396
      setNewPopupDatasetName(infoDict.datasetName)
397
    }
386 398

  
387 399
    setGlobalPopupContent(getPopupContent(datasetDictNameDisplayName[infoDict.datasetName], place, number, total, 1, info_.length))
388 400

  
......
396 408
      globalPopup._popup = prepareLayerPopUp(lat, lng, i, `popup-${datasetName}`)
397 409
      globalPopup.coord = eventCoord
398 410
    }
411
    else {
412
      setNewPopupDatasetName(datasetName)
413
    }
399 414

  
400 415
    setGlobalPopupContent(genMultipleDatasetsPopUp(number, 1, getCountPagesInPopup(), datasetDictNameDisplayName[datasetName]))
401 416
  }

Také k dispozici: Unified diff